Employee motivation is one of the most important drivers of productivity, workplace satisfaction, and long-term organizational success. When employees feel motivated, they are more engaged, more committed to their work, and more willing to go beyond basic job requirements. One of the most effective ways organizations can boost motivation is through well-structured leadership training programs.

Leadership training programs have a direct impact on how managers and supervisors interact with their teams. When leaders are https://protraining.net/our-solutions/leadership/ trained to communicate clearly, listen actively, and provide constructive feedback, employees feel more valued and understood. This sense of recognition plays a major role in increasing motivation because people are naturally more committed when they feel their contributions are appreciated.

Another important factor is trust. Leadership training helps managers develop stronger interpersonal skills and emotional intelligence, which improves trust between leaders and employees. When employees trust their leaders, they are more likely to stay motivated even during challenging situations. They feel confident that their efforts are aligned with the organization’s goals and that their work has meaning and purpose.

Leadership training programs also improve motivation by creating a more positive work environment. Trained leaders learn how to manage conflict effectively, reduce workplace tension, and promote teamwork. A healthy and supportive environment reduces stress and allows employees to focus more on their tasks. When the workplace atmosphere is positive, motivation naturally increases.

Clear goal setting is another key factor influenced by leadership development. Leaders who receive proper training understand how to set realistic, measurable, and achievable goals for their teams. When employees know exactly what is expected of them and how their performance will be evaluated, they feel more focused and driven. Clear direction eliminates confusion and helps employees stay motivated to achieve targets.

In addition, leadership training encourages recognition and reward systems. Effective leaders learn the importance of acknowledging employee achievements, whether big or small. Recognition boosts morale and motivates employees to maintain or improve their performance. Simple gestures such as appreciation, feedback, or encouragement can significantly increase motivation levels.

Leadership training also helps reduce micromanagement, which can negatively affect employee motivation. Instead of closely controlling every task, trained leaders learn to delegate responsibilities and trust their teams. This autonomy gives employees a sense of ownership over their work, which increases confidence and motivation.

Furthermore, leadership programs help leaders identify individual strengths within their teams. When employees are assigned tasks that match their skills and interests, they are more likely to feel engaged and motivated. Proper alignment between strengths and responsibilities leads to better performance and higher job satisfaction.

Overall, leadership training programs play a powerful role in shaping employee motivation. By improving communication, building trust, encouraging recognition, and creating a supportive environment, these programs help employees stay engaged and committed to their work. Motivated employees not only perform better but also contribute to a stronger, more productive, and more successful organization.
